Popular Chicken Nanban

cookpad.japan
cookpad.japan @cookpad_jp

Chicken nanban is a specialty of my native Miyazaki Prefecture. It's a family recipe I learned from my grandmother.

The secret to tender meat is to coat the chicken in the sweet vinegar sauce as soon as they are finished frying. Recipe by Kiguchanchi

Ingredients

3 servings
  • 2 filletsChicken thighs (chopped into bite-sized pieces)
  • 1Plain cake flour
  • 2Eggs
  • 1for frying Oil
  • 60 grams☆ Sugar
  • 100 ml☆ Vinegar
  • 50 ml☆ Soy sauce
  • 25 ml☆ Water
  • 3Eggs (hard boiled)
  • 1/6Onions (finely chopped)
  • 1 tbspPickles (minced)
  • 1 tbspParsley (finely chopped)
  • 4to 5 tablespoons Mayonnaise
  • 1 tspWhite wine or sake (optional)
  • 1/8of a lemon Lemon juice
  • 1Salt and pepper

Steps

  1. 1

    Prepare the tartar sauce. Boil the egg for 8 to 10 minutes, finely mince, then put them in a bowl. Mince the onion and soak in water.

  2. 2

    Mince the pickles and parsley, then add to the bowl from Step 1. Add the lemon juice and white wine.

  3. 3

    Drain the onion and soak excess water with a paper towel. Add the onion to the bowl, then add mayonnaise, salt, and pepper, and mix. There you have the tartar sauce.

  4. 4

    Prepare the sweet vinegar sauce. Put the ☆ ingredients in a sauce pan, then heat. Bring to a boil, then turn off the heat.

  5. 5

    Beat the eggs in a bowl. Chop the chicken into bite-sized pieces, coat in flour, then dredge in the beaten eggs.

    A picture of step 5 of Popular Chicken Nanban.
  6. 6

    Heat oil in a frying pan on medium heat. Deep fry the chicken in oil heated to 180°C. Flip over the pieces occasionally and cook through thoroughly.

    A picture of step 6 of Popular Chicken Nanban.
  7. 7

    Dunk the fried chicken in the sweet vinegar sauce. It should sizzle at this point. Allow the sauce to absorb into the coating, then transfer to a serving plate.

    A picture of step 7 of Popular Chicken Nanban.
  8. 8

    Serve the chicken coated in the sweet vinegar sauce with a generous amount of tartar suace, then serve.
